Cuts

If at first

you don’t make it

Failure may just

be your style

No

Not your fashion

Failure may just

 be your soulmate

She is bad

No

Not as bad

As you once imagined

Not as pitiful

As you once dreaded

She’s always there

For one thing

She answers “yes”

Every time you ask

Her tailoring may

may not be crisp

Not the cuts

that you so much cherished

Not the swag

that you  admired

But she’ll give you a hug

a hickey

She’ll find you a lounge

 a lesson

And when you open

the caverns

of your heart

She gives up her top

secret

the private lives

of the men she courted

Success is not

the medal you sought

It’s certainly not

the end of the journey

Success is the

journey

You win

when you are primed

for another

blind date

You win

when you lose

that thing

That fear of finding

that failure

is once again

 your blind date
